你查询的IP:[121.51.220.113]  地理位置:中国–上海–上海

最新查询123.112.20.32 119.44.146.124 122.156.26.30 210.12.243.30 124.254.21.77 161.207.50.208 210.32.173.145 119.254.35.8 119.44.8.129 121.51.220.113 202.43.144.232 203.88.192.179 121.89.119.215 202.127.160.115 124.172.5.165 203.175.128.62 123.137.221.83 134.196.56.5 202.170.128.189 221.176.33.124 120.137.158.22 61.48.108.193 125.32.32.6 202.148.96.55 118.112.153.149 60.63.29.2 203.135.96.234 121.55.192.112 123.196.131.22 116.248.249.21 116.216.49.24